The answer is 'true'. The Wormsley common gang are a group of characters in the book 'The Destructors'. The book was written in 1954 by Graham Green. The setting of the book is post World War II England in a region where the neighborhood was virtually destroyed by bomb blasts. The physical and psychological effects of the war planted the seed for the gang's destructive actions.
